Twentieth-century women of courage

Escott, Beryl E.1999
Books
Squadron Leader Beryl Escott describes dozens of acts of bravery where women have placed their lives in great danger, usually in order to save a life. The subjects come from the UK, the USA, Canada, Australia, New Zealand and South Africa.
